what kind of dog is a cane corso:   History and Origins

 

 

The Cane Corso has a rich history that dates back to ancient times. Believed to be descendants of the Roman Molossus dogs, these canines were used as guardians and hunters by the ancient Romans. The breed’s name, “Cane Corso,” is derived from the Latin word “cohors,” which means guardian or protector. Throughout history, Cane Corsos were valued for their strength, agility, and loyalty.

In the 20th century, the Cane Corso faced a decline in numbers, with the breed nearly becoming extinct. However, dedicated breed enthusiasts worked tirelessly to revive the breed, leading to its resurgence in popularity. Today, the Cane Corso is recognized for its versatility as a working dog, family companion, and loyal guardian.

 

 

what kind of dog is a cane corso:   Physical Characteristics

 

 

The Cane Corso is a large and muscular dog with a distinctive appearance. These dogs have a short coat that comes in various colors, including black, fawn, brindle, and gray. Their strong build and athletic physique make them well-suited for various tasks, from guarding to agility sports.

One of the most striking features of the Cane Corso is its imposing head, which is broad and square-shaped. Their expressive eyes convey intelligence and attentiveness, reflecting their keen awareness of their surroundings. With a confident gait and powerful presence, the Cane Corso commands attention wherever it goes.

 

 

what kind of dog is a cane corso:   Temperament and Behavior

 

 

Despite their imposing appearance, Cane Corsos are known for their gentle and affectionate nature towards their families. These dogs form strong bonds with their owners and are fiercely loyal and protective. While they may appear reserved around strangers, they are devoted companions who thrive on human interaction.

Cane Corsos are intelligent and trainable dogs, but they require consistent training and socialization from an early age to channel their protective instincts appropriately. With proper guidance and leadership, these dogs can excel in various activities, including obedience training, agility, and even therapy work.

It is essential to note that Cane Corsos have a strong prey drive and protective instincts, making them natural guardians. Responsible ownership includes providing them with proper socialization, exercise, and mental stimulation to ensure they remain well-adjusted and balanced companions.

 

 

what kind of dog is a cane corso:   Care and Maintenance

 

 

Due to their size and energy levels, Cane Corsos require regular exercise to stay healthy and happy. Daily walks, playtime, and mental stimulation are essential to prevent boredom and destructive behaviors. Additionally, providing them with a balanced diet tailored to their needs is crucial for their overall well-being.

Grooming the Cane Corso is relatively low-maintenance, thanks to their short coat. Regular blow-drying helps keep their coat healthy and reduces shedding. Routine dental care, nail trimming, and ear cleaning are also important aspects of their grooming routine to prevent any health issues.

 

 

 

what kind of dog is a cane corso:   weight

 

 

 

Cane Corsos are a large and powerful breed of dog, known for their impressive stature and muscular build. On average, male Cane Corsos typically weigh between 100-120 pounds, while females range from 80-110 pounds. These dogs are solidly built with a robust frame that exudes strength and agility. It’s important to note that individual dogs may vary in size within these ranges based on factors such as genetics, diet, and exercise.

When considering the weight of a Cane Corso, it’s crucial to ensure they maintain a healthy balance to support their overall well-being. Proper nutrition and regular exercise are essential in managing their weight effectively. Additionally, consulting with a veterinarian can provide valuable guidance on maintaining an optimal weight for your Cane Corso based on their specific needs and lifestyle. Understanding the weight range of this breed is key in providing them with the care and attention they require to thrive happily and healthily.

what kind of dog is a cane corso:   Ask Questions

 

 

When considering bringing a Cane Corso into your home, it’s essential to ask the right questions to ensure you are prepared for this powerful breed. Start by inquiring about the breeder’s reputation and experience with Cane Corsos. Ask about the health history of the puppy’s parents and if they have been screened for any genetic conditions common in the breed. Additionally, inquire about the socialization efforts made with the puppy and its littermates to ensure they are well-adjusted and confident.

It is also crucial to ask about training recommendations for a Cane Corso, as their size and strength require consistent and firm leadership. Inquire about exercise needs, dietary requirements, grooming routines, and potential behavioral challenges specific to this breed. By asking these questions upfront, you can better understand what to expect when welcoming a Cane Corso into your family and provide them with the care and environment they need to thrive.
